Opal R. Siewert

PORTAGE  -- Opal R. Siewert, age 88, of Portage, passed away on Monday, February 2, 2009 at Heritage House in Portage, surrounded by her loving family.

Funeral services will be held at 6:00 p.m. on Wednesday, February 4, 2009 at Pflanz Mantey Mendrala Funeral Home in Portage, with the Rev. David Hankins officiating.  Private family burial will be in Oak Grove Cemetery.  Visitation will be from 4:00 p.m. until the time of the service on Wednesday, February 4, 2009 at the Pflanz Mantey Mendrala Funeral Home in Portage.

Opal was born on June 17, 1920 in Madison, the daughter of Walter and Florence (Kelly) Lipke.  She was married on September 12, 1941 to Franklin “Coach” Siewert.  Opal was a member of Bethlehem Lutheran Church in Portage.  Opal will be remembered as a devoted wife and loving mother and grandmother.  She was defined by her modest demeanor and sense of humor.  She had great concern for the well being of others and valued the friendship of many.
